Cara Shapiro v. Le Creuset of America, Inc., et al
Plaintiff: Cara Shapiro
Defendant: Does, Le Creuset of America, Inc. and Schiller Stores, Inc.
Case Number: 2:2016cv05408
Filed: July 20, 2016
Court: US District Court for the Central District of California
Presiding Judge: Alka Sagar
Presiding Judge: George H. Wu
Nature of Suit: Consumer Credit

Date Filed Document Text
August 24, 2017 Opinion or Order Filing 48 ORDER RE STIPULATION FOR DISMISSAL PURSUANT TO F.R.C.P. 41(a)(1)(A)(ii) by Judge George H. Wu, re Stipulation to Dismiss Case 47 . GOOD CAUSE APPEARING, it is ordered that this action is dismissed with prejudice as to the claims of the Plaintiff. Case Terminated. Made JS-6. (smo)
August 16, 2017 Opinion or Order Filing 46 ORDER TO SHOW CAUSE RE: SETTLEMENT by Judge George H. Wu. On July 27, 2017, Plaintiff Cara Shapiro filed a Notice of Settlement. The Court sets an Order to Show Cause re: Settlement Hearing for September 18, 2017 at 8:30 a.m. The parties are advised that the order to show cause will be vacated and no appearance will be required provided that a Stipulation to Dismiss, with a proposed order, is filed by noon on September 15, 2017. All previously set deadlines and dates are vacated and taken off-calendar. (smo)
February 2, 2017 Opinion or Order Filing 37 PROTECTIVE ORDER by Magistrate Judge Alka Sagar re Notice of Lodging 34 . (See document for complete details) (afe)
October 5, 2016 Opinion or Order Filing 24 (IN CHAMBERS) ORDER TO SHOW CAUSE RE SUBJECT MATTER JURISDICTION by Judge George H. Wu: [T]he Court orders the parties to provide further information regarding the size of the putative class and aggregate amount in controversy no later than October 1 2, 2016, or address whether Plaintiff can or must, at the removal stage revise the class definition in order to make these determinations. The parties may respond to those October 12 submissions, if they choose to do so, by October 19, 2016. All briefs are limited to 10 pages, and the parties are reminded that courtesy copies are to be delivered to Chambers. The hearing on this OSC will be held on October 27, 2016 at 8:30 a.m. (cr)
